Understanding Real-Time Data Monitoring

Real-time data monitoring refers to the continuous collection, analysis, and visualization of data as it is generated. Unlike traditional reporting systems that operate on scheduled updates, real-time monitoring delivers instant visibility into operations and performance metrics.

This allows businesses to identify issues immediately, optimize workflows, and make informed decisions based on current conditions rather than historical information.

Supporting Predictive Maintenance

In industries that rely on machinery and equipment, predictive maintenance has become increasingly important. Real-time monitoring systems can detect performance irregularities and alert teams before equipment failures occur.

This proactive approach helps businesses reduce maintenance costs, minimize downtime, and extend equipment lifespan.
